Impact Windows Beat Hurricane Shutters in Doral, Unless Your Budget Says Otherwise

For most Doral homeowners, impact windows are the better long-term investment than hurricane shutters. They cost more upfront, roughly $55 to $85 per square foot installed versus $8 to $30 for shutters, but they protect your home every single day without you lifting a finger. Why This Decision Is Different in Doral Than Anywhere Else in Florida

Doral sits directly beneath Miami International Airport’s primary runway corridors. That’s not a footnote, it’s the whole conversation. Miami-Dade County already mandates High-Velocity Hurricane Zone (HVHZ) impact-rated glazing on new construction and major renovations, so every home built in Doral’s 2000-2015 boom already has some form of impact protection. What those homes don’t all have is protection from the constant rumble of landing gear and jet engines that rattles windows on NW 107th Avenue and every street east of the Turnpike.

Shutters block wind. They don’t block sound. Impact windows do both. That’s why so many Doral homeowners who started out shopping for accordion shutters end up sitting across from us comparing laminated glass packages instead. The dual-spec conversation, acoustic plus impact, is the real decision in nearly every Doral window sale we do.

The Honest Tradeoff: Day-One Cost vs. Every-Day Protection

We can walk you through both and we’ll quote both side by side. Here’s what the numbers actually look like in Doral today:

  • Hurricane shutters: $8 to $30 per square foot, installed. Lowest entry price. But they only work when someone is home to deploy them, and they do nothing for noise, UV fading, or a failed window seal.
  • Impact windows: $55 to $85 per square foot, installed, depending on frame material and the level of acoustic laminate you choose. Always on, zero effort, and they qualify for wind mitigation insurance credits that shutters on older openings sometimes don’t capture.
  • Hybrid approach: Some Doral townhome owners put impact glass on the street-facing and MIA-facing sides and use panels or accordions on the rest. It’s a legitimate way to phase the cost without leaving the house vulnerable.

Shutters aren’t a bad product. They’re a bad fit if you’re home during storms with mobility concerns, if you travel during hurricane season, or if your HOA restricts exterior-mounted hardware. Which brings us to the next point.

Doral’s HOA Reality Changes the Math

Doral’s housing stock is overwhelmingly gated communities and townhome clusters built between 2000 and 2015. That’s a critical detail. Those associations have architectural review committees, and many of them restrict what can be bolted to the exterior of a unit. We’ve walked into communities in Doral where accordion shutters aren’t allowed on front elevations, or where roll-down housings have to be recessed and color-matched, which erases most of the cost advantage.

Here’s the local angle most window companies won’t tell you: because a small set of South Florida production builders put nearly identical fenestration packages into these Doral developments, entire HOA communities hit seal failure and hardware corrosion at roughly the same time. We’ll get a call from one unit, and within six months we’re quoting the whole block. When a community-wide replacement program is already on the horizon, putting money into shutters mounted over builder-grade impact windows that are about to fog is spending twice for the same opening.

What Shutters and Impact Windows Both Won’t Fix in This Climate

South Florida’s heat and humidity are hard on everything, but they’re especially hard on insulated glass. Sustained 80%+ humidity and relentless UV pull apart silicone seals before you’d ever see it happen in a northern climate. Doral’s 2003-2013 construction boom means a lot of those original builder-grade PGT and CGI units are hitting the ten to fifteen year seal-failure window right now. Fogged panes, wavy glass, condensation you can’t wipe off: that’s a failed thermal seal, and neither shutters nor a new impact window solves the problem if the frame around it was set out of true.

Side-by-Side: Impact Windows vs. Hurricane Shutters in Doral

When we sit down with a Doral homeowner, here’s the comparison we put on paper:

Factor Impact Windows Hurricane Shutters
Upfront cost $55-$85 per sq ft installed $8-$30 per sq ft installed
Deployment Always on, zero effort Manual or motorized; must be home
Aircraft noise reduction Significant, especially with acoustic laminate None while retracted
UV and fade protection Blocks majority of UV, day and night Only when shutters are closed
HOA compatibility No exterior footprint change Often restricted by architectural committee
Insurance discounts Typically qualifies for wind mitigation credits Varies by product and install
Lifespan 15-20+ years with proper install 10-15 years, plus maintenance on tracks and motors

For a Doral homeowner who travels during storm season or lives in an HOA that restricts exterior hardware, the answer is usually impact glass, even with the higher entry price. For a seasonal resident in a concrete-block mid-rise with a tight budget, shutters can be a defensible stopgap.

What We Actually Recommend in Doral

If your home still has the original builder-grade windows from the 2000s and you’re asking this question, the most common answer we give is: replace the windows now, skip the shutters, and put the savings into acoustic-rated laminate. You get storm protection you don’t have to think about, you solve the aircraft noise problem no shutter can touch, and you address the seal failures that are already showing up across Doral’s townhome communities.

If your windows are newer and in good shape, shutters are a reasonable hold until the glass actually needs replacing. Just don’t invest in a shutter system over windows that are five years from failing. That’s how people end up paying for the same opening twice.
